ALEXANDRIA, Va., Dec. 16 -- United States Patent no. 12,497,715, issued on Dec. 16, was assigned to GENUS INDUSTRIES INC. (Oregon City, Ore.).
"Method and apparatus for rinsing coir" was invented by David E. Shoup (Oregon City, Ore.).
